Abstract
This master thesis analyses the fundamentals of the air – conditioning (A/C) measurements. In the introduction there was created the structure of the general A/C systems organised in accordance with their principle and a summary of the essential requirements which these systems have to meet. Also there was created the list of commonly measured quantities of these systems. As an example there was described in detail a modern car A/C system including used components. In the next part of the thesis there is created a summary of the technical requirements of the features, principles, appropriate ranges and required accuracy of the commonly used sensors. In the final part were provided model measurements. The first measurement was provided at the A/C pressure sensor to find out its basic features like repeatability, accuracy and linearity in accordance with normative technical procedures. The goal of the second measurement, provided at the lab A/C system, was to find out the ideal maximum amount of refrigerant required. This measurement needed to determine most of the main functional quantities to control when the A/C system reaches the ideal balance between the highest efficiency of the system and its maximum charge. The performed measurement was used as an experience to develop a better measurement procedure and to provide changes, which increases the accuracy of the measurement of the system. The particular changes carried out and the summary of the results achieved are described in the concluding part.
